The sea of clouds in Tomamu, Hokkaido is a mesmerizing natural phenomenon that can be witnessed in the morning. When you ascend to higher altitudes, on some days, you are treated to a magnificent spectacle. This captivating sight is an unforgettable experience even for foreigners. Surrounded by the serene mountains, the sensation of floating above a sea of clouds truly represents the charm of Hokkaido.